Can you explain this vulnerability to me?
This vulnerability is a flaw in the Transbyte Scooper News App (up to version 1.2) on Android. It involves improper export of Android application components due to an issue in the AndroidManifest.xml file of the component com.hatsune.eagleee. This improper export can be manipulated by an attacker who has local access to the device, potentially allowing unauthorized access or actions within the app.
How can this vulnerability impact me? :
The vulnerability can impact you by allowing an attacker with local access to exploit the improper export of app components, which may lead to unauthorized access or manipulation of the app's functionality. This could compromise the confidentiality, integrity, and availability of data or app operations.
